Hurray! ABC Family has acquired the basic-cable rights to all five seasons of the hit show Friday Night Lights! The channel will begin airing episodes this September.

The show is about a competitive Texas high school football team, the Dillon Panthers, and every season the show gets better and better. The show is currently in it’s fourth season, and according to reports the fifth season will be its last.

Tom Zappala, ABC Cable Networks’ Executive Vice President of Program Acquisitions and Scheduling, said about ABC acquiring the rights to air Friday Night Lights:

We’re thrilled to add NBC’s critically acclaimed series Friday Night Lights to the mix of our defining original and quality acquired series. The series is beloved by critics and viewers, and fits in perfectly with ABC Family’s blend of optimistic, heartfelt programming.
